Warning Signs

Signs you need termite control in Hickory Valley.

  • Pencil-thin mud tubes running up foundation walls or piers
  • Wood that sounds hollow when tapped, or crumbles under light pressure
  • Discarded, translucent swarmer wings near windowsills, especially in spring
  • Small piles of frass (termite droppings) resembling sawdust near wood structures
  • Blistering or darkening of painted wood surfaces, often mistaken for water damage

02

Does homeowners insurance cover termite damage?

Almost never. Termite damage is considered a preventable maintenance issue, not a covered peril, which is why routine inspection is the most cost-effective protection.

03

How often should I get a termite inspection in Hickory Valley?

An annual inspection is standard, though properties with known conducive conditions — moisture issues, wood-to-soil contact, prior termite history — benefit from more frequent checks or an active monitoring program.
